Artist Biography
Combining astral sound beds with earnest romantic confessionals, Mariah the Scientist makes love songs that are as yearning as they are futuristic. Born Mariah Buckles, the Atlanta native began singing as a member of her elementary school choir. After dropping out of St. John's University to pursue a music career, she garnered attention in 2018 with To Die For, a six-song EP that caught the ear of Tory Lanez. In 2019, she crystallized her status as an emerging voice with her major-label debut, Master. Checking in at 10 tracks, the project is coated in hazy production, dazed vocals, and visceral longing, a stylistic constellation found across her discography. While collaborating alongside rap luminaries like Young Thug and Lil Baby, she only refined her technique with RY RY WORLD (2021) and To Be Eaten Alive (2023), releases that affirmed her as one of R&B's most engrossing creators.
